Transaction

7f4e3940ba2f9a8e5481941925efc40316a0ea603f9622961aca3a5b3afae6da

Summary

In Block353648
TimeWed, 13 Sep 2023 01:55:00 UTC
Total Input2313.42525498 Nebula
Total Output2368.42525498 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
327715 Confirmations2368.42525498 Nebula
Raw Transaction